Understanding the Essence of Dingbats Fonts
Before diving into the specific applications of Doodles Decorate, it is essential to understand what a dingbats font actually is. Historically, "dingbats" referred to typographical symbols, such as flowers, stars, or geometric shapes, used to break up text or fill space. In the digital age, the term has evolved to describe fonts where every letter, number, and symbol on your keyboard is mapped to a specific image or icon rather than a standard character.
For example, if you install a standard text font, pressing the letter "A" results in the printed letter A. However, if you install a dingbats font like Doodles Decorate, pressing "A" might produce a small illustration of a Christmas tree, a balloon, or a decorative swirl. This mechanism allows users to access hundreds of unique vector graphics simply by typing, eliminating the need to search for separate image files or clipart. How to Use Dingbats Effectively
Using a dingbats font requires a slightly different workflow than using standard text fonts. To get the most out of Doodles Decorate, consider the following tips:
- Consult the Character Map: Most dingbats fonts come with a "cheat sheet" or PDF that shows which keyboard key corresponds to which image. Keep this guide handy. You will find that pressing "Q" might give you a gift box, while "W" gives you a ribbon.
- Size and Spacing: Because these are vector graphics, they can be scaled to any size without pixelation. However, be mindful of the spacing (kerning) between characters. You may need to adjust the tracking in your design software so that the icons don't overlap awkwardly or sit too far apart.
- Color Application: Since the icons are text, you can change their color just like you would change the color of a letter. This allows you to create multi-colored designs by highlighting different characters and applying different hues.
- Combining with Serif/Sans-Serif: Doodles Decorate works best when paired with a clean, legible text font. Use the doodles for accents and headers, and pair them with a simple sans-serif font for the body text to ensure readability.
